Experiences of Philipp Spielbusch.

Philipp Spielbusch is an outstanding IT expert. Awake, agile and always up to date. His gnarled clientele in the wild expanses of Westphalia, on the other hand, sets "12345" as the password in the computer behind the unguarded counter of the land market or angrily asks him to change the ink in his (!) fax machine because their sheets come out white. Furthermore, the dog is always barking "when the WiFi whistles." In his office, that Philipp shares with the taciturn Wulf, he doesn't have it any easier. At the glass table sits the uninvited permanent guest Jonas and knits conspiracy theories. On the phone, the mother is sure that she just now has unintentionally deleted the internet.
An everyday report from the front, which became so well known nationwide that people passing through on the A1 leave the motorhway and head to Drensteinfurt in order to take a look at Philipp and his cult office.

Live.

Der Weindieb | The Wine Thief

Der Weindieb | The Wine Thief

Short novel by Wilko Weiss.

A new hero, but his familiar theme: Country life does not let go of Wilko Weiss as a writer. In this short novel it's about Tim Brigg and his wife Laura. He writes below his level as a columnist for a local newspaper, she's an advertising designer and brings four fifths of the income home. That's something that Tim could actually not care about, if it weren't for his unbearably successful neighbour Mr. Petersen. This surgeon is athletic, well-read and eloquent, handsome, a connoisseur of wine and competent in all things. When the man goes on his ski vacation, Tim and Laura are looking for his house and pug a bottle of wine for their guests, which turns out to be an antique treasure.
A timeless comedy about neighbourly relationships, about deception and self-deception and about how one can reconcile himself with his fate quite well.

Der Hausmann Der Hausmann | The House Husband

Der Hausmann | The House Husband

Novel by Wilko Weiss.

Ben Breuer is a controller and has had everything under control so far. His job. His family life with his wife Marie and the children Lisa and Tommy. His male friendship with Gregor, the permanent bachelor, who always has some cold Kölsch beer ready. When Ben's company goes bankrupt, a career door opens for Marie shortly afterwards. So far she has not been challenged in her profession as an architect with a small home studio for a long time. Now she commutes to the big city, and Ben runs the business at home as a house husband. The tasks that he has to perform between raising children, training the cat and doing home office, overwhelm him enormously. So he secretly outsources them to service providers who must never meet his wife.
A special gift tip is the audiobook: The actor Holger Stockhaus tells this story in such a great role-playing speech as if he were a whole ensemble.
